Turf Transition

Residents may be wondering why some of the turf areas in the community are still green and others are brown and bare. The areas that look dead are those that are in preparation for overseeding. Some areas of the community are not being overseeded to allow stronger Bermuda growth in the spring, and they will remain green for awhile.
